The differences between bridge teachers and certified substitute teachers can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, a bridge teacher has an average salary of $47,326, which is higher than the $37,177 average annual salary of a certified substitute teacher.
The top three skills for a bridge teacher include student learning, mathematics and classroom behavior. The most important skills for a certified substitute teacher are classroom management, student learning, and classroom environment.
| Bridge Teacher | Certified Substitute Teacher | |
| Yearly salary | $47,326 | $37,177 |
| Hourly rate | $22.75 | $17.87 |
| Growth rate | 4% | 4% |
| Number of jobs | 53,524 | 87,422 |
| Job satisfaction | - | - |
| Most common degree | Bachelor's Degree, 70% | Bachelor's Degree, 69% |
| Average age | 42 | 42 |
